Output 0db3d7a8e68828f5a746cc2b910a8f42cf973107302d884b3cc5b9796b352104:64

value
21440942
script pubkey
OP_0 OP_PUSHBYTES_20 bfd20c268ccb7e82ddb82de702b663bb41a02baa
address
bc1qhlfqcf5vedlg9hdc9hns9dnrhdq6q2a2rhrhhg
transaction
0db3d7a8e68828f5a746cc2b910a8f42cf973107302d884b3cc5b9796b352104